#3c2398 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c2398 is composed of 23.5% red, 13.7%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.5% cyan, 77%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 252.8 degrees, a saturation of 62.6% and a lightness of 36.7%. #3c2398 color hex could be obtained by blending #7846ff with #000031.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#3c2398 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3c2398 has RGB values of R:60, G:35,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 3941272.

Shades and Tints of #3c2398
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030209 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fd is the lightest one.
